Chicago's Union Station was built in 1925 and today is owned by Amtrack and is the hub for Midwestern trains and for trains serving the west.

This is the start for many grand rail adventures to tour the USA.

Amtrack offers many tour packages. You can board the California Zephyr for a trip to Yellowstone and Grand Teton National Parks. There are two week long package trips to see 5 of America's national parks on the Empire Builder. You can book a trip for an autumn tour of New England. So many tour package possibilities start right here.
